Superior Sound Quality

One of the main reasons why audiophiles and recording enthusiasts still prefer reel to reel audio tape is its superior sound quality. Unlike digital formats that compress audio files and can result in lossy compression artifacts, reel to reel tape captures sound in an analog format with high fidelity. The magnetic tape used in these systems preserves every nuance and detail of the original recording, providing a warmer and more natural sound compared to digital counterparts.

Moreover, reel to reel tape machines often offer adjustable playback speed options, allowing users to tailor the sound characteristics according to their preference or specific requirements. This level of customization is not easily achievable with digital formats.

Archival Durability

When it comes to long-term storage and preservation of audio recordings, nothing beats physical media like reel to reel audio tapes. Digital storage mediums are subject to the risk of data corruption, hardware failure, or obsolescence. On the other hand, reel to reel tapes, when properly stored and maintained, can remain playable for decades.

The durability of magnetic tape against environmental factors such as temperature and humidity variations makes it an excellent choice for archiving important recordings. Additionally, with proper care and periodic re-recording to fresh tapes, reel to reel audio tape provides a reliable and stable medium for preserving valuable audio content.

Authentic Analog Experience

Using reel to reel audio tape allows individuals to experience the authentic analog recording process in its entirety. From recording on analog equipment to physically splicing and editing the tape, each step in the workflow adds a unique charm that cannot be replicated by digital software alone. This hands-on approach not only provides a greater sense of connection with the recorded material but also cultivates a deeper understanding of the art of audio engineering.

Moreover, using reel to reel tape can inspire creativity through limitations. The constraints imposed by working with physical media often lead to innovative solutions and experimentation that may result in unique sonic characteristics or artistic choices.
